Excessive overtime leads to overspending for your company and overworked staff—on top of various employment laws and labor regulations to consider. Managing overtime is a crucial topic for HR and managers to plan for and address. Overtime issues are often the result of problems elsewhere in the company.

Remote recruiting is HumanResources’ fastest growing strategy within talent acquisition to meet the needs of an evolving work environment. Remote recruitment involves the sourcing, screening, interviewing, and hiring of employees located throughout the world. Traditional means of recruitment used to entail a multi-step process.
